58- CNC Programı Nasıl Yazılır ve Nelere Dikkat Edilmelidir?
Bir CNC programı yazmak, manuel programlamanın en son adımıdır. Bu son adım, parçayı işlemek için gereken blokların bir ya da daha çok kağıt kullanılarak yazılması gibidir. CNC programı, işleme ilgili çeşitli talimatlar ve bir dizi ardışık komut bloğu halinde düzenlenir. Yazmak, sanılanın aksine sadece tükenmez ya da kurşun kalem kullanmak değildir. Modern yazma yöntemleri, yazmak için kağıt yerine bilgisayar ya da metin düzenleyicileri kullanmaktır.Ancak hem modern hem de eski yöntemlerin sonucu işlenecek parça için yazılan programın yazılı ya da basılı bir kopyasıdır. Manuel programlama, uzun bir çalışmanın sonucudur. Birkaç satır kod ile sonlanacak bir program, kağıda yazılmak yerine doğrudan kontrol sistemine girilebilir. Ancak dokümantasyon ve diğer referanslar için yazılı kopya da gerekli olacaktır. Teknolojinin her geçen gün geliştiği bir ortamda elle programlama biraz demode gibi görünse de, basit programlar için yakın zamanda kullanılmaya devam edecek bir yöntemdir.
Bir programı manuel olarak yazmak hem zaman gerektiren hem de hatalara açık bir süreçtir. Manuel çalışma aynı zamanda elle çalışmak anlamına gelir, bu nedenle bilgisayar becerilerinin herhangi bir etkisi yoktur. Peki, bu doğru bir değerlendirme mi? Geleneksel yöntemde program, bir kalem ve kağıtla yazılır. Oluşturulan programın son hali kontrol ünitesine aktarılır ve ayrıca çeşitli klavye tuşları kullanılarak kısa bir program doğrudan sisteme girilebilir. Uzun programlar içinse bu yaklaşım tam olarak bir zaman kaybıdır.
Kağıt ve kaleme modern bir alternatif, düz ASCII metinlerden oluşan dosyalar oluşturmak için kullanılabilecek bir metin editörü ve onu çalıştıracak bir bilgisayar klavyesidir. Bilgisayar yazılımı, CNC programını sabit sürücüde depolanacak şekilde oluşturur. Bu dosya daha sonra yazdırılabilir ya da doğrudan CNC makinesine gönderilir. Tek fark, klavyenin kalemin yerini ve metin düzenleyicinin de silginin yerini almasıdır. Bugün hala kalem, hesap makinesi ve silgi kullanılarak büyük miktarda manuel programlama işi yazılı olarak yapılmaktadır.
Kontrol sisteminin bir programı yorumlama şeklini, sözdizimi kullanımını, kaçınılması gerekenleri ve hangi formatın doğru olduğunu öğrenmek gereklidir. Hiç manuel programlama yapmasanız bile, gerekli durumlarda CAD/CAM sistemi ile geliştirilen çıktılar üzerinde değişiklik ve özelleştirme yapmanız gerektiğinde, program yazma tekniklerinin ilkelerini bilmeniz önemlidir. CNC programı kolayca yorumlanabilecek şekilde yazılmalıdır.
Bir CNC programı yazmak, manuel programlamanın en son adımıdır. Bu son adım, parçayı işlemek için gereken blokların bir ya da daha çok kağıt kullanılarak yazılması gibidir. CNC programı, işleme ilgili çeşitli talimatlar ve bir dizi ardışık komut bloğu halinde düzenlenir. Yazmak, sanılanın aksine sadece tükenmez ya da kurşun kalem kullanmak değildir. Modern yazma yöntemleri, yazmak için kağıt yerine bilgisayar ya da metin düzenleyicileri kullanmaktır.Ancak hem modern hem de eski yöntemlerin sonucu işlenecek parça için yazılan programın yazılı ya da basılı bir kopyasıdır. Manuel programlama, uzun bir çalışmanın sonucudur. Birkaç satır kod ile sonlanacak bir program, kağıda yazılmak yerine doğrudan kontrol sistemine girilebilir. Ancak dokümantasyon ve diğer referanslar için yazılı kopya da gerekli olacaktır. Teknolojinin her geçen gün geliştiği bir ortamda elle programlama biraz demode gibi görünse de, basit programlar için yakın zamanda kullanılmaya devam edecek bir yöntemdir.
Bir programı manuel olarak yazmak hem zaman gerektiren hem de hatalara açık bir süreçtir. Manuel çalışma aynı zamanda elle çalışmak anlamına gelir, bu nedenle bilgisayar becerilerinin herhangi bir etkisi yoktur. Peki, bu doğru bir değerlendirme mi? Geleneksel yöntemde program, bir kalem ve kağıtla yazılır. Oluşturulan programın son hali kontrol ünitesine aktarılır ve ayrıca çeşitli klavye tuşları kullanılarak kısa bir program doğrudan sisteme girilebilir. Uzun programlar içinse bu yaklaşım tam olarak bir zaman kaybıdır.
Kağıt ve kaleme modern bir alternatif, düz ASCII metinlerden oluşan dosyalar oluşturmak için kullanılabilecek bir metin editörü ve onu çalıştıracak bir bilgisayar klavyesidir. Bilgisayar yazılımı, CNC programını sabit sürücüde depolanacak şekilde oluşturur. Bu dosya daha sonra yazdırılabilir ya da doğrudan CNC makinesine gönderilir. Tek fark, klavyenin kalemin yerini ve metin düzenleyicinin de silginin yerini almasıdır. Bugün hala kalem, hesap makinesi ve silgi kullanılarak büyük miktarda manuel programlama işi yazılı olarak yapılmaktadır.
Kontrol sisteminin bir programı yorumlama şeklini, sözdizimi kullanımını, kaçınılması gerekenleri ve hangi formatın doğru olduğunu öğrenmek gereklidir. Hiç manuel programlama yapmasanız bile, gerekli durumlarda CAD/CAM sistemi ile geliştirilen çıktılar üzerinde değişiklik ve özelleştirme yapmanız gerektiğinde, program yazma tekniklerinin ilkelerini bilmeniz önemlidir. CNC programı kolayca yorumlanabilecek şekilde yazılmalıdır.
İlgili Yazılar
62- CNC Programlamada Cihaz Arayüzü
Hatalardan arındırılmış ve en iyi performansı elde etmek üzere
63- CNC Programlamada Matematik Nasıl Kullanılır?
Programlamada matematik, pek çok programcı için o kadar güçlü
38- Tek Noktadan Diş Açma
Birleştirme ve ayırma işlemleri sırasında iki parçayı zarar görmeden
49- CNC Programlamada Alt Programlar
Bir CNC programındaki karakter sayısı genellikle programın uzunluğunun ölçümünde
50- CNC Programlamada Veri Kaydırma İşlemi Nedir?
CNC programlarının çoğu, atölyede bulunan belirli bir makinede yapılacak
51- CNC Programlamada Ayna Görüntüsü Ne Anlama Gelmektedir?
CNC programlarını geliştirmenin amacı, parça ya da makine üzerindeki